2.Print on Demand Powerhouse: Have a creative eye for design? Partner with a print-on-demand service to sell your t-shirts, mugs, phone cases, and more! These companies handle printing and fulfillment, allowing you to focus on design and marketing.

Earning Potential: Royalties per product sold, usually a percentage of the selling price. The income depends on the product type, design complexity, and profit margin set during product creation.

Example: David, a graphic designer with a passion for pop culture, creates witty and eye-catching designs featuring popular movie quotes and characters. He partners with a reputable print-on-demand service, uploading his designs onto various products. David utilizes social media platforms like Instagram to showcase his work and connect with potential customers. Through targeted advertising campaigns, he drives traffic to his print-on-demand store, generating a passive income stream as his designs get purchased on different products.

Getting Started: Choose a reliable print-on-demand service that offers a wide range of product options and high-quality printing. Design eye-catching graphics using user-friendly design software. Market your products through social media and explore targeted advertising to reach your target audience.

3.The Bookish Entrepreneur: Are you a wordsmith with compelling stories or insightful knowledge? Self-publish your ebook on platforms like Amazon Kindle Direct Publishing (KDP),shabd.in, Blue Rose One, Kobo, Apple Books,Notion Press,Barnes & Noble Press, Draft2Digital,Smashwords etc. This route offers high royalty rates and global reach, allowing you to share your work with a vast audience.
Earning Potential: Varies based on book sales and pricing. Royalties can range from 35% to 70% of the selling price, depending on whether you choose to go exclusive with Amazon or distribute your book through wider channels.

Example: Emily, a retired teacher with a passion for historical fiction, has penned a captivating novel set during the French Revolution. After undergoing professional editing and cover design, she self-publishes her ebook on KDP. Through engaging social media promotion and participating in online book communities, Emily builds awareness for her book. As readers discover and enjoy her story, she earns royalties on each purchase, achieving her dream of sharing her work with the world.

Getting Started: Write and edit your book to a professional standard. Invest in professional editing and cover design services to enhance its appeal. Format your book for ebook platforms and utilize KDP or other self-publishing platforms to launch your book. Implement effective book marketing strategies to reach your target readers.

4.Freelance Flier: Do you have a specific skillset in high demand? From writing and editing to graphic design and web development, freelance marketplaces like Upwork, Fiverr, Truelancer, PeoplePerhour,Bark.com,Toptal,Skyword360 etc. offer a plethora of opportunities to connect with clients and secure paid projects.
Earning Potential: Varies widely based on experience, skills, project rates, and the number of projects secured. Experienced freelancers with specialized skills can command higher rates.

Example: John, a seasoned web developer with a strong portfolio, uses Upwork to connect with businesses looking to build or revamp their websites. He sets competitive rates based on his experience and project complexity. By delivering exceptional work and exceeding client expectations, John builds a positive reputation and secures repeat business. This allows him to generate a consistent income stream as a freelance web developer.
Getting Started: Create a compelling profile on freelance marketplaces showcasing your skills and experience. Set competitive rates based on your expertise and the market average. Build a strong portfolio with high-quality samples of your work. Deliver exceptional client service to secure positive ratings and repeat business.

5.Virtual Assistant Rockstar: Are you a master organizer and administrative whiz? Become a virtual assistant, providing administrative, technical, or creative support to busy clients remotely.
Earning Potential: Hourly rates typically range from $15 to $50 depending on experience and offered services. Virtual assistants with specialized skills like social media management or bookkeeping can command higher rates.

Example: Maria, a highly organized individual with excellent communication skills, works as a virtual assistant for a busy entrepreneur. She handles tasks like scheduling appointments, managing email communication, and maintaining social media accounts. Maria’s efficiency and proactive approach free up the entrepreneur’s time, allowing them to focus on core business activities. This mutually beneficial arrangement provides Maria with a flexible income stream and a valuable learning experience.

Getting Started: Develop a strong understanding of virtual assistant services in high demand. Hone your communication, organizational, and technical skills. Build a professional online presence through a website or social media profiles. Utilize platforms like Zirtual or Fancy Hands to find clients or connect with businesses directly.

6.The Social Media Maven: Do you have a knack for crafting engaging social media content? Businesses are increasingly outsourcing their social media management to individuals who can create, schedule, and track the performance of their posts.
Earning Potential: Can range from $1,000 to $5,000 per month per client, depending on the scope of work and industry. Social media managers handling accounts for large brands or managing multiple accounts can command higher fees.

Example: Lisa, a social media enthusiast with a strong understanding of current trends, manages the social media presence for a local bakery. She creates visually appealing posts showcasing the bakery’s delicious pastries and interacts with customers online. Lisa analyzes engagement metrics and implements social media marketing strategies to increase brand awareness and drive website traffic. Through her expertise, she helps the bakery reach a wider audience and attract new customers.

Getting Started: Build a strong social media presence showcasing your content creation skills. Learn about social media analytics and scheduling tools. Connect with businesses through social media platforms or freelance marketplaces, demonstrating your understanding of their target audience and social media goals.

7.The Dog Walker with a Swagger: Do you love animals and enjoy spending time outdoors? Dog walking and pet sitting services are always in demand. Offer personalized care to furry friends while getting some exercise yourself.
Earning Potential: Hourly rates typically range from $15 to $25 per walk or visit, depending on location, services offered, and the number of pets cared for. Offering additional services like pet taxiing or medication administration can increase your earning potential.

Example: Rajat, a college student with a passion for animals, offers dog walking and pet sitting services in his neighborhood. He tailors his services to individual pet needs, providing walks, playtime, and companionship. Noah’s reliability and genuine love for animals earn him a loyal client base of pet owners who trust him with their furry companions. This flexible side hustle allows him to generate income while enjoying the company of animals.

Getting Started: Obtain pet CPR and first-aid certification to demonstrate your commitment to pet safety. Ensure you have proper insurance coverage in case of any accidents. Market your services through local pet stores, online platforms like Rover, or by word-of-mouth recommendations from satisfied clients.

8.The Rental Revolution: Do you have a spare room, unused equipment, or a car sitting idle? Leverage the sharing economy by renting them out on platforms like Airbnb, Turo, or Fat Llama.
Earning Potential: Varies depending on the item rented, location, and rental duration. A spare room in a desirable location could fetch a significant sum, while renting out specialized equipment might have a smaller but lucrative market. Short-term rentals typically generate higher income per day compared to long-term rentals.

Example: Michael, living in a trendy city center, lists his spare bedroom on Airbnb. He furnishes the room comfortably and sets competitive rates based on local listings. By maintaining a clean and welcoming space, and offering excellent hospitality, he attracts a steady stream of travelers. This allows Michael to generate passive income by utilizing a space that would otherwise be unused.
Getting Started: Choose a platform that aligns with your offerings, like Airbnb for rooms or Turo for cars. Take high-quality photos, write clear descriptions highlighting unique features, and set competitive rates. Ensure you understand and comply with local regulations regarding rentals.

9.The Ridesharing Regatta: Do you enjoy driving and meeting new people? Ridesharing services like Uber and Lyft offer flexible hours and the potential to earn decent income, particularly in busy cities and during peak hours.
Earning Potential: Varies based on location, driving hours, and passenger demand. Some drivers report earning over $20 per hour during peak times, but earnings can fluctuate.

Example: Janet, a recent college graduate, utilizes Uber as a side hustle to supplement her part-time job. She enjoys the flexibility of setting her own schedule and chooses to drive during evenings and weekends when demand is higher. By providing a clean and comfortable ride with friendly conversation, Sarah builds positive ratings with passengers, leading to repeat rides and increased earning potential.

Getting Started: Meet the platform’s vehicle and driver requirements, pass a background check, and complete required training. Utilize their app to find and accept rides, prioritizing passenger safety and a positive experience.

15.The Transcriptionist Trailblazer: Do you have excellent typing skills and a discerning ear? Become a transcriptionist, converting audio and video recordings into written text. This side hustle offers flexibility and can be done from anywhere with a computer and internet connection.
Earning Potential: Varies based on experience, project complexity, turnaround time, and chosen platform. Typical rates range from $15 to $30 per hour, with specialized transcription (e.g., legal or medical) potentially commanding higher fees.

Example: Manoj, a college student with exceptional listening skills, finds work as a transcriptionist on a freelance platform. He transcribes audio recordings from interviews, lectures, and webinars, ensuring accuracy and meeting deadlines. John’s efficiency and attention to detail earn him positive feedback from clients, leading to repeat business and a steady stream of income.

Getting Started: Develop strong typing skills and hone your listening comprehension. Choose a reliable transcription platform or find freelance work through online marketplaces. Ensure you have the necessary equipment and software for transcription, such as a foot pedal and specialized software.

17.The Voiceover Virtuoso: Do you have a captivating voice and excellent communication skills? Offer your voiceover talents for projects like audiobooks, explainer videos, or commercials. Many online platforms connect voice actors with clients, offering flexible work opportunities.
Earning Potential: Varies based on project type, length, and your experience level. Rates can range from $50 to several hundred dollars per project, with more complex projects commanding higher fees.

Example: James, a radio host with a rich and engaging voice, explores voice acting as a side hustle. He creates a profile on a voiceover platform showcasing his voice samples and demos. By specializing in audiobooks for a specific genre, David attracts clients and lands projects narrating historical fiction novels. He utilizes his recording equipment at home to deliver high-quality voiceovers remotely, generating income while leveraging his vocal talents.

Getting Started: Invest in a good quality microphone and recording equipment to ensure professional-sounding audio. Develop a clear and versatile voice with strong articulation and appropriate pacing. Create a demo reel showcasing your voice acting range and upload it to online platforms or voice acting agencies.

19.The Data Entry Dynamo: Do you have excellent attention to detail and typing skills? Data entry involves inputting information into digital formats, ensuring accuracy and efficient data processing. This side hustle offers flexibility and can be done from home with a computer and internet connection.
Earning Potential: Varies based on project complexity, accuracy requirements, and the chosen platform. Typical rates range from $10 to $20 per hour. Specialized data entry jobs, like medical coding, may offer higher earning potential.

Example: Karan, a stay-at-home dad with strong typing skills, finds data entry work through a freelance platform. He ensures accuracy while efficiently inputting data from scanned documents or online forms. John’s meticulous attention to detail earns him positive feedback and repeat projects from satisfied clients, allowing him to generate income while maintaining a flexible schedule.

Getting Started: Develop strong typing skills and ensure you have a reliable internet connection and a computer. Familiarize yourself with common data entry tools and terminology. Consider obtaining certifications specific to the data entry field for higher-paying opportunities. Explore online platforms or freelance marketplaces that offer data entry jobs.

20.The Online Survey Specialist: Do you enjoy sharing your opinions and influencing brands? Many platforms offer paid online surveys that allow you to earn points or cash for completing surveys on various topics. While the income per survey may be small, it can add up over time, especially if you participate in a multitude of surveys.
Earning Potential: Varies widely based on the survey platform, survey length, and the topic covered. Short surveys might reward a few cents, while longer and more complex surveys can offer a dollar or more.

Example: Kim, a college student looking for a flexible way to earn some extra cash, signs up for several online survey platforms. She completes surveys in her free time, sharing her opinions on various products and services. While the income from each survey is modest, the collective earnings help Emily alleviate some financial pressure and contribute to her savings goals.

Getting Started: Choose reputable online survey platforms with a good track record of rewarding participants. Be honest and accurate in your responses, as platforms may remove unreliable participants. Explore various survey platforms to find opportunities that align with your interests and maximize your earning potential.

21.Cash In: A great way to Earning Through Referrals
Referral programs offer a straightforward way to earn extra money by simply sharing your experiences.

Whether you’re a tech enthusiast, a shopping aficionado, or someone looking for a side hustle, referral programs can be a lucrative avenue.  

How Do Referral Programs Work?

Typically, companies offer incentives to existing customers for referring new users. You’ll receive a unique referral link or code to share with your network. When someone signs up or makes a purchase using your link, you earn a commission or reward.  

Popular Referral Methods

E-commerce Platforms: Many online stores, such as Amazon, Flipkart, and Myntra, have referral programs. You can earn a percentage of your friend’s first purchase or receive store credits.  
Financial Services: Banks and investment platforms often reward referrals with cash bonuses, gift cards, or exclusive perks. For instance, referring a friend to open a savings account can earn you both rewards.
Ride-Sharing and Food Delivery: Companies like Uber, Ola, and Zomato offer referral bonuses for new user sign-ups. Share your referral code with friends to earn free rides or food discounts.  
Online Services: Platforms like Dropbox, Grammarly, and Evernote provide referral incentives for bringing in new users. You can earn additional storage space, premium features, or cash rewards.  
Getting Started

Identify Your Network: Determine who might be interested in the products or services you use. Friends, family, and social media followers are a good starting point.
Choose the Right Programs: Select referral programs that align with your interests and target audience. Consider factors like reward structure, terms and conditions, and the company’s reputation.  
Leverage Your Network: Share your referral links on social media, through email, or in person. Create engaging content to encourage sign-ups.  
Track Your Earnings: Keep a record of your referrals and commissions to monitor your progress.

Tips for success

Be Genuine: Recommend products or services you genuinely believe in. Authentic endorsements are more effective.
Offer Incentives: Consider providing additional incentives to your referrals to increase sign-ups.
Follow Up: Remind your referrals about the benefits of using the service and how they can support you by signing up.
